There is currently tension in Maiduguri, capital of Borno state, due to an attack by the Boko Haram sect.

A resident of Addawari village, Jiddari-Polo area, told TheCable that the insurgents have been shooting since about 5:30pm.

“We have been indoors for the past two hours. Sounds of gunshot everywhere. We can’t even go out to break our fast,” the resident said.

TheCable observed hundreds Giwa barracks residents, leaving in droves.

Security operatives, who were trying to repel the insurgents, assured residents of their safety, but many fled their homes and sought safety in nearby locations.

Sani Usman, spokesman of the Nigerian Army, asked residents to keep calm.

“The people of Maiduguri and its environs should not panic, as everything is under control,” Usman said.

The attack happened at a time Tukur Burutai, chief of army staff, was at his official residence in Giwa barracks.
